Medical and surgical innovations have allowed to shorter length of hospital stay (LOS).
We assume that hospitals with uncontrolled reduction in LOS may expose patients to unsafe
care. At the institutional level, a dynamic analysis of LOS evolution over time could
clarify the existence of a link with the risk of readmission.
